Let me clarify your query in two parts; (1) To get admission in PGDM, you need to submit your Bachelors mark sheet and university certificates. Since you are currently doing B.Ed so it is not possible to take admission in PGDM course from any university, even if it is distance or regular. (2) Doing dual degree from two different universities is very risky. However, there is no offense (if you have submitted valid documents) but is will create an excessive pressure and tension over you. It is very hard to handle two subjects at same time.

72% was the cut-off list in 2017 for BMM in St.Xaviers College. Generally, the forms are available online in the month of April and the entrance exam happens in the month of June.
